Massage Therapy

Impact Fitness offers a full line of massage services with all massage therapists certified and having years of experience working in the field.  For your convenience, we will perform massages either in the comfort of your home, office, or gym.

MENU

SWEDISH: Traditional Swedish massage consists mainly of long strokes over oiled skin, and kneading the outer layers of muscle tissue to reduce stress and soothe sore joints and muscles.

DEEP TISSUE: This powerful therapeutic treatment targets the body’s deepest muscle layers and releases tension in overstressed areas. But be forewarned: If this is your first massage or if you don’t get much exercise you could end up very sore the day after!

MEDICAL: Massage in a more focused manner, with the intent to treat a specific injury or condition (Sciatica, bursitis, carpal tunnel syndrome and TMJ, among others.)

SPORTS:
This technique enhances performance, increases endurance and expedite recovery.

PRENATAL/POSTNATAL: Designed to relieve prenatal discomforts as well as reduce water retention, lower back pain and sciatica. After birth, massage will help speed the natural recovery process and diminish stretch marks.

REFLEXOLOGY:
The foot is a microcosm of the entire body. Massaging specific pressure points on the feet stimulates precise parts of the body, relieving e.g. stress, PMS or headaches.

SHIATSU: Eastern healers have used acupressure-point massage for thousands of years to balance QI, life energy. Performed on a floor mat, the client wears comfortable, loose fitting clothes.

THAI MASSAGE:
“Yoga for lazy people.” The client wears comfortable clothing during this massage form. It incorporates stretching, gentle rocking and specific pressure point work.

HOT STONE: Basalt stones are heated and rubbed over the oiled body, then, placed on different parts of the body to enhance the relaxing effects of the stones’ warmth and pressure.
